Sketch for L'Oubilé

Sketch for L'Oubilé

Theodore RousselWW-1915-015627
1915·Gouache on cream laid paper, discolored to tan·7.5 × 17.4 cm (3 × 6 7/8 in.)

<p>Toward the end of his life, after years of experimentation with color intaglio processes, Roussel developed a novel technique for producing painterly multiples. These works were pulled from fabric plates that had been “inked” with a thick, opaque, water-based medium. The plates were disposable and could be recut from paper templates.</p>

Theodore Casimir Roussel (1847–1926) was a French-born English painter and graphic artist, best known for his landscapes and genre scenes.
